Determine Your Intentions

Using your first and last name is currently one of the most popular ways to name a YouTube channel. Yes, this method will result in poor SEO optimization. However, if the content is adequate, it is unnecessary. The videos will then spread on their own, transforming your unique YouTube channel name into a brand. This method is also beneficial for users who are already famous. If you want to create a channel on behalf of a company, then it makes sense to use your brand. For example, the official Coca-Cola channel goes by that name. Furthermore, they create content for multiple countries. That is why they have a large number of channels created using the same scheme “Coca-Cola + Country Name”. However, my experience indicates that whatever method you select should be based on the following:

  • Theme. It is preferable to use at least one keyword in naming. At the same time, it must be organic;
  • Specifics. Traditionally, all YouTube channels should be divided into educational and entertainment categories. This feature should be considered when deciding on a project name;
  • Target audience. This is one of the most important considerations when communicating with others. If you want to build relationships with a target audience of 40 or older, avoid using youth slang in your title. However, when working with children, it can be extremely beneficial. Let’s also include communication with potential advertisers. They will be demanding of all aspects of the channel;
  • YouTube Rules. The platform has a concept called “controversial tags”. These are questionable combinations that are associated with violence, adult content, foul language, etc.

How to Create a Memorable Name

I am convinced that any naming should begin with defining the concept before moving on to the topic. The theme is the topic you will be discussing. For instance, automobiles. And the concept refers to the points of view you want to emphasize or convey. Decide whether your channel will be about you or your topic. Do you believe you are such an interesting person that others will come to watch you? Or is your expertise more valuable than a pitch? There are a few rules to follow when naming, no matter what the concept is:

Simpler is better

Many people are advised to go with the shorter option. However, this is a serious misconception that demonstrates that people do not understand the branding process. In fact, the first step is to prioritize simplicity of pronunciation.

Think strategically

Your channel name and concept should not be based on current trends. Otherwise, you’ll be forgotten as soon as you’re discovered.

The name does not need to be one you like

Bloggers frequently choose good YouTube usernames based on whether they like them or not. However, it makes no difference in the real world. It is better to prioritize search algorithms. If you don’t want to mention your channel’s name in your videos, you can leave it out. The main point is that it works well.

What Name Should Be?

Of course, there are no set criteria. There are always workable exceptions. If you are confident that your choice will be an exception, you may disregard some recommendations. However, based on my experience, I strongly recommend following these rules:

Do not include Show or TV in the name

Such names for your project are already out of style. As a result, many users will subconsciously associate them with something outdated. Do you want to come up with a repulsive name?

The name doesn’t have to be English

There are already a large number of channels with names in English. In today’s world it sometimes happens that on the contrary, a very unusual (but easy to remember) name attracts more attention.

Do not use any other brands

Sometimes YouTubers use a company’s intellectual property in their titles without realizing it. For instance, “Michael is a Windows expert”. This already covers a narrow topic. With further expansion, the likelihood of losing everything increases, as large corporations can block your channel for unfair use. This has happened even with lesser-known bloggers.

Don’t make the name too long

First and foremost, it is about search. YouTube’s algorithms prioritize videos over user profiles. Let’s say you decide to call your channel “Jason is all about fixing cars”. Users will never completely enter it into a search. And YouTube is more likely to recommend other videos to users based on specific words. Furthermore, brand names with a few syllables are easier to remember than those with dozens of words.

The name should reflect the essence

This point can be considered controversial. Still, there are many channels with bad naming that have gained popularity. However, it is important to realize that a vague name will make it difficult to promote for newcomers. Therefore, try to describe your art or chosen direction in one or two words.

Don’t follow others

If you are thinking about developing by linking to popular YouTube bloggers, you should reconsider. This will do you no good in the beginning and will only make things worse what to say about the stage when you have a large crowd. Check all of the resulting names for competition and uniqueness.

Additional Name Selection Strategies

If you’re having trouble coming up with the best name for a YouTube channel, consider changing your approach to generating options:

Contact someone you know

Consider bringing in someone with a new perspective. Furthermore, having two heads can generate more ideas. Different hobbies and ways of thinking will also help you generate a wider range of options.

Create multiple variants at once

If you want to find a unique name for a YouTube channel, don’t just go with the first option. Consider as many options as possible. It is common for the tenth idea to be the best, rather than the first. It is best to first create a list of at least 20 options.

Collect opinions

You should prepare a list of questions to ask people you know. This is not the most effective method of analysis, but it is accessible to the majority of people. It is important to determine not only how much you enjoy the YouTube name style, but also how it stands out, is readable, and memorable.
